Consider the reaction

2Na(s) + 2H2O(l) ? 2NaOH(aq) + H2(g)

When 2 moles of Na react with water at 25°C and 1 atm, the volume of H2 formed is 24.5 L. Calculate the magnitude of work done in joules when 0.15 g of Na reacts with water under the same conditions. (The conversion factor is 1 L · atm = 101.3 J.)
